Every Ember & Iron event follows a carefully structured agenda that balances classroom education with live-fire range time. Here is what a typical event day looks like:
Participants arrive and check in. The atmosphere is relaxed and social — refreshments are provided, name badges are distributed, and instructors personally introduce themselves to every attendee. This is the time to ask questions, meet other women, and settle in before the training begins.
A comprehensive safety briefing covers the five cardinal rules of firearm safety, range etiquette, proper grip and stance, sight alignment, and trigger control fundamentals. Instructors use training firearms (blue guns and dry-fire tools) to demonstrate techniques before anyone approaches the firing line. Florida concealed carry law basics are also introduced, including an overview of Florida Statute 790 and Florida Statute 776 regarding justifiable use of force.
The main event. Participants move to the firing line in small groups with dedicated instructor supervision. Each shooter receives one-on-one coaching on grip, stance, sight picture, and trigger press. Multiple firearm platforms are available for participants to try — from compact pistols ideal for concealed carry to full-size handguns optimized for home defense. Ammunition and eye and ear protection are provided. Instructors maintain a maximum ratio of one instructor per three to four shooters to ensure personalized attention and absolute safety at all times.

What should I wear to the event?
Wear closed-toe shoes (no sandals or flip-flops), a high-collar or crew-neck top (to prevent hot brass from contacting skin), and comfortable clothing that allows free movement. Avoid low-cut tops and loose scarves.
